About Christine Turner

Christine Turner is a scholar working on Paleontology, Earth-Surface Processes and Geochemistry and Petrology, having authored 20 papers that have together received 474 indexed citations. Recurring topics across this work include Paleontology and Stratigraphy of Fossils (8 papers), Geological formations and processes (7 papers) and Geology and Paleoclimatology Research (3 papers). The work is most often cited by research in Paleontology (243 citations), Earth-Surface Processes (135 citations) and Geochemistry and Petrology (61 citations). Christine Turner has collaborated with scholars based in United States and Australia. Frequent co-authors include Fred Peterson, Neil S. Fishman, Judith Totman Parrish, Nicholas J. Ashbolt, Rhys Leeming, Mark Rayner, Peter D. Nichols, Robert Frodeman, Herman A. Karl and Peter J. McCabe. Their work appears in journals such as Journal of Chromatography A, Geological Society of America Bulletin and Sedimentary Geology.
